Saint-Quentin

   Also found in: Encyclopedia, Wikipedia 0.01 sec.
Saint-Quentin (French) [sɛ̃kɑ̃tɛ̃]
n usually abbreviated to St-Quentin
(Placename) a town in N France, on the River Somme: textile industry. Pop.: 62 085 (1990)
